Sprint Treo 650 updated for DUN

Jun 17 2005 - 12:43 AM ET | Sprint Nextel
PalmOne and Sprint have released an update to the Treo 650 that enables among other things, the much awaited dial up networking support. The DUN feature allows Treo 650 owners to connect other Bluetooth devices (most commonly a laptop) to the Sprint data network. Other changes in version 1.12 include: * Updates VersaMail to version 3.1 to enhance stability and add improvements * Adds support for more Bluetooth carkits including Acura, BMW, Chrysler, Toyota Prius (see all compatible car kits) * Reduces post-dial delay before a call is connected * Send SMS messages from Missed Call Alert or Call Log MobileTracker has both a review of the Treo 650 and a list of the top accessories.
